A U.S. hospital fills the garage with beds after increasing cases with Coddy-19

A U.S. hospital fills the garage with beds after increasing cases with Coddy-19

Because of increased cases with Coddy-19, the Mississippi University Medical Center has filled the underground parking lot with beds. The hospital had taken similar action in the spring of 2020, when it was the peak of the first wave of pandemic. Despite the deterioration of the situation, the governor of Mississippi from the Republican Party's ranks, Tate Reyes, said he welcomes the aid from federal workers, but pledged that he would never force residents to wear masks, though this is called an effective way of preventing the spread of the virus.

“I believe that each individual should do what he believes is the best decision for himself”, he said. Reeves shot that he and his family have been vaccinated, but there are risks related to both vaccines and disincentives, Reuters writes, broadcast Express newspaper.

The lower vaccine rate and the more contagious option, Delta, have caused increased the number of cases of Covid-19 throughout the United States, in some parts of the health system.

The number of hospitals has also increased. On Friday, there were 1,871 children in the United States lying in hospitals, more than any other period of pandemic.
